创客编程教学学些什么
-
创客编程教学是指将创客教育与编程教育相结合,通过让学生学习编程知识和技能,培养他们的创新思维和实践能力。在创客编程教学中,学生学习的内容包括以下几个方面:
-
编程语言和算法:学生需要学习一门或多门编程语言,例如Scratch、Python、Java等,掌握编程的基本概念和语法规则。此外,学生还需要学习算法的基本原理和常用算法,如排序算法、搜索算法等。
-
电子原理和硬件知识:创客编程教学强调的是学生通过编程来控制硬件的实现,因此学生需要学习一些基本的电子原理和硬件知识,如电路原理、传感器原理、电子元器件等。
-
创客实践和项目开发:学生在创客编程教学中需要进行各种创客实践和项目开发,例如制作电子游戏、设计机器人、开发智能设备等。通过实践和项目开发,学生可以将所学的编程知识应用到实际场景中,提高他们的创新能力和解决问题的能力。
-
团队合作和沟通能力:在创客编程教学中,学生通常需要与其他同学一起合作完成项目。因此,学生需要培养团队合作和沟通能力,学会与他人协作、分工合作、共同解决问题。
-
创新思维和问题解决能力:创客编程教学注重培养学生的创新思维和问题解决能力。学生需要通过自主学习和独立思考,解决实际问题和面对挑战,培养创新思维和解决问题的能力。
综上所述,创客编程教学学习的内容包括编程语言和算法、电子原理和硬件知识、创客实践和项目开发、团队合作和沟通能力,以及创新思维和问题解决能力。通过学习这些内容,学生可以培养创新思维、实践能力和解决问题的能力,为将来的创业和职业发展打下坚实的基础。
1年前 -
-
创客编程教学是指通过创客教育的方式来教授编程知识和技能。创客编程教学的目的是培养学生的创造力、解决问题的能力和团队合作精神。在创客编程教学中,学生不仅仅是被动地接受知识,而是通过实践和实际项目来学习编程。以下是创客编程教学中学生需要学习的几个方面:
-
编程基础知识:创客编程教学首先要教授学生基本的编程概念和基础知识,包括编程语言的语法、变量、循环、条件语句等。学生需要学习如何使用编程语言来编写程序,并理解程序的运行原理。
-
创意思维:创客编程教学注重培养学生的创意思维能力。学生需要学习如何将自己的创意转化为可行的编程项目,并学会解决问题的能力。通过创客项目的实践,学生可以锻炼自己的创造力和解决问题的能力。
-
项目管理和团队合作:创客编程教学强调学生的项目管理和团队合作能力。学生需要学习如何规划和组织自己的创客项目,并与其他团队成员合作完成项目。这包括任务分配、进度管理、沟通协作等能力的培养。
-
制造技能:创客编程教学也涉及到一些制造技能的学习。学生需要学习如何使用各种创客工具和设备,如3D打印机、激光切割机等。他们还需要学习如何设计和制造自己的创客产品,并学习相关的工程知识和技术。
-
创业思维:创客编程教学也注重培养学生的创业思维。学生需要学习如何将自己的创意转化为商业价值,并学习相关的市场营销和商业模式等知识。他们需要学习如何将自己的创客项目推向市场,并学会如何与投资者和客户进行沟通和合作。
总之,创客编程教学是一种注重实践和项目的教学方法,通过培养学生的编程能力、创意思维、团队合作和制造技能等方面的能力,来培养学生的创造力和创业精神。创客编程教学不仅仅是教授学生编程知识,更重要的是培养学生解决问题的能力和创新精神。
1年前 -
-
创客编程教学是指通过让学生参与实际的创造和编程项目,培养他们的创造力、解决问题的能力和计算思维。在创客编程教学中,学生不仅学习编程语言和技术,还学习如何使用各种工具和材料来设计和制作自己的创意作品。创客编程教学的目标是培养学生的创新精神和实践能力,让他们成为具有创造力和解决问题能力的未来创业者和创造者。
下面是创客编程教学中需要学习的几个重要方面:
-
编程语言和技术:学生需要学习一种或多种编程语言,如Scratch、Python、Java等。他们需要学习编程的基本概念,如变量、条件语句、循环等,以及如何使用编程语言来解决问题和实现创意。学生还需要学习如何使用各种编程工具和软件来编写、调试和运行程序。
-
电子电路和硬件:创客编程教学还涉及到学习电子电路和硬件知识。学生需要了解电子元件的基本原理和功能,以及如何使用它们来设计和制作电路。他们还需要学习如何使用各种传感器、执行器和其他电子设备来实现自己的创意。
-
机械设计和制作:创客编程教学还包括学习机械设计和制作的知识。学生需要学习如何使用CAD软件来设计物体,并学习如何使用3D打印机、激光切割机等工具来制作自己的设计。
-
创意思维和解决问题能力:创客编程教学注重培养学生的创意思维和解决问题能力。学生需要学习如何提出创新的创意,如何将创意转化为实际的产品和项目,以及如何解决在创造和编程过程中遇到的问题。
-
团队合作和沟通能力:创客编程教学通常是以小组为单位进行的,学生需要学习如何与团队成员合作,共同完成项目。他们还需要学习如何有效地沟通和交流,以便与他人分享和展示自己的创意和成果。
创客编程教学是一种综合性的学习方式,需要学生综合运用多种技能和知识。通过创客编程教学,学生可以不仅学习编程和技术知识,还可以培养创造力、解决问题的能力、团队合作和沟通能力等重要的综合素养。
1年前 -